WebMay 18, 2024 · What is fish productivity? Randall and his colleagues defined fish productivity as the sustained yield of all component populations and species and their habitat which contributes to a fishery. What is fish effort? A fishing effort is how much fishing is involved. WebAug 21, 2024 · “Independent of trends in phosphorus, there are some suggestions that … WebApr 7, 2014 · Ecosystem externalities can affect fishery productivity in a variety of ways altering recruitment, growth rates, and natural mortality. Often, though not always, these are negative externalities that reduce productivity. Some fishing methods can be highly destructive to the habitat that supports the fishery.
